How Common Is The Last Name Fileger? popularity and diffusion

The last name is the 2,352,516th most widely held family name worldwide, borne by around 1 in 110,417,362 people. This surname occurs mostly in The Americas, where 97 percent of Fileger live; 97 percent live in North America and 97 percent live in Anglo-North America.

It is most frequent in The United States, where it is borne by 64 people, or 1 in 5,663,421. In The United States Fileger is most numerous in: Florida, where 52 percent reside, Pennsylvania, where 27 percent reside and Virginia, where 11 percent reside. Outside of The United States this surname occurs in 2 countries. It is also common in Germany, where 2 percent reside and Poland, where 2 percent reside.

Fileger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The occurrence of Fileger has changed through the years. In The United States the share of the population with the surname increased 1,067 percent between 1880 and 2014.
